Quantifying Physiological Gains

Effective progress monitoring requires consistent measurement of specific health markers across the entire baseball season. Players should track body composition changes alongside energy levels to determine if their caloric intake matches their output. By recording how different macronutrient ratios affect recovery speed, individuals can refine their personal strategies. This process is much like a bank account, where consistent deposits of quality nutrients allow for larger withdrawals of physical effort during intense games. When an athlete records these details, they transform their nutrition from a guessing game into a reliable, evidence-based system that supports long-term durability.

Key term: Performance indicators — the measurable data points that track how well a nutritional plan supports an athlete’s physical output and recovery.

Evidence shows that tracking these metrics helps reveal patterns that are otherwise invisible to the naked eye. For instance, a player might notice that specific carbohydrate timing correlates with higher bat speed in the final innings of a game. When individuals use these insights, they shift their focus from generic advice to highly tailored solutions that meet their unique physiological needs. This level of detail allows for rapid adjustments during a long, demanding season. By treating nutrition as a variable that changes with the schedule, players maintain their peak form far longer than their peers who ignore these data trends.

Integrating Data into Daily Routines

To manage these complex variables, athletes often use a structured approach to record their daily nutritional intake and physical outcomes. This method creates a clear record that helps identify which habits lead to success and which habits hinder recovery. The following list outlines the most critical categories for tracking long-term health and performance:

  • Hydration status involves monitoring fluid loss and electrolyte balance to ensure the body maintains optimal function during high-heat games — failing to track this often leads to cramps and reduced focus.
  • Recovery quality measures how quickly muscle soreness fades after heavy training sessions by comparing protein intake timing to the perceived level of physical fatigue experienced by the athlete.
  • Energy consistency tracks how sustained glucose levels impact performance throughout a full nine-inning game — this data helps refine the timing of complex carbohydrate consumption to prevent late-game slumps.

This systematic approach ensures that nutrition remains a priority even during the most stressful points of the competitive calendar.
